The difference between morphology and physiology is that morphology is that branch of biology that studies structures or organisms, while physiology is that branch of biology that studies the functions of organisms and their different parts. As nouns the difference between morphology and physiology is that morphology is (uncountable) a scientific study of form and structure, usually without regard to function especially: while physiology is a branch of biology that deals with the functions and activities of life or of living matter (as organs, tissues, or cells) and of the physical and chemical phenomena involved. The art of dissecting, or artificially separating the different parts of any organized body, to discover their situation, structure, and economy; dissection. Plant morphology "represents a study of the development, form, and structure of plants, and, by implication, an attempt to interpret these on the basis of similarity of plan and origin".
